How Traders Can Be "Hungrier" (Without Being Dishonest)


In Episode 288 of The Traders Podcast, your host Rob Booker tries out his new Microsoft Surface and gives us a report on how he likes it. This leads Rob to a conversation about companies that seem to be hungrier than their competitors — stopping at nothing to be a force to reckon with in the marketplace through extreme tactics and sheer desire. Rob talks about what happens when a trader becomes similarly determined and committed. As an example of a hungry trader, Rob cites Traders Podcast listener Calvin.
